
Description & origin
The scented geranium is a popular aromatic plant known for its citrus fragrance. Its leaves are finely cut and have an interesting texture.
Size
Compact plant, ideal for pots and gardens.
Foliage
Leaves should be kept clean to avoid pests.
Flowering
Blooms in summer, attracting pollinators.

Common problems
Aphid infestations
Aphids can infest the leaves, causing damage and deformities.
Fungal issues
Excess moisture can lead to fungal development on leaves.
Dry leaves
Leaves may dry out if the plant does not receive enough water.
Uses & curiosities
In the garden
- Ideal for borders and beds
- Great for balconies and terraces
- Used in floral and aromatic arrangements
Other uses
Can be used in infusions and cooking.
Did you know…
The leaves of the scented geranium are often used to flavor drinks and dishes. It is a hardy plant that adapts well to various conditions.
